Raising the Bar in the CVCS Junior High

We are raising the bar at CVCS for all junior high students. Our high academic standards and
the importance of holding all students accountable has lead to some changes in course labels
and expectations. When you get your schedule, you may notice that the word “honors” does not
appear in the course titles. This does not mean that we are eliminating course content or
standards. Quite the opposite, we are dedicated to increasing rigor across the board. For
example, in the past, only students enrolled in eighth grade “honors” English classes received
summer reading. This year all eighth grade students are expected to complete summer reading.
Our math placement tests, led by Mr. Prouty, will continue to be the qualifying factor for
scheduling. This will allow for appropriate placement according to each student's math skills.
This placement test will continue to group students in other academic courses. In all classes,
teachers will continue to differentiate instruction to motivate, challenge, and excite your child.
We have found that while schools differ in how they label classes, some of the most respected
and academically rigorous schools in the area have also moved to similar course labels. The
culture at CVCS is built on academic excellence and we plan to continue that tradition.
